Definite weird stuff from the Swiss Alps where freak weather
reportedly dumped 80,000 tonnes of fine sand from the Sahara onto ski
slopes, cars and streets.
Ski slopes turned brown and car washes were overwhelmed as people
queued to wash the reddish sand from their vehicles. The sand was
sucked up from the Sahara by rising water vapour before heading
across the Med carried by clouds, along the Spanish coast and across
France to Geneva where rain carried the red dust back to earth.
